728x90
728x90
1. 서두 이번 포스팅에선 JavaScript의 기본 객체 중, Promise를 이용한 비동기(Asynchronous)적 처리에 대해 정리했다. 만약 비동기적 처리와 JavaScript의 비동기적 처리 방법에 대해 모르고 있다면 필자의 이전 글을 먼저 읽고오길 바란다. 2021.12.05 - [SW/Typescript] - [Typescript] JavaScript의 비동기(Asynchronous)적 처리 [Typescript] JavaScript의 비동기(Asynchronous)적 처리 1. 서두 이번 포스팅에서는 JavaScript의 비동기적 처리 방법에 대해 정리했다. 우리가 이용하는 JavaScript는 Single-Thread 언어이다. 그로인해 JavaScript는 동시에 한 가지의 작업만 처..
1. 서두 이번 포스팅에서는 JavaScript의 비동기적 처리 방법에 대해 정리했다. 우리가 이용하는 JavaScript는 Single-Thread 언어이다. 그로인해 JavaScript는 동시에 한 가지의 작업만 처리할 수가 있어서 A라는 작업을 처리한 후 B라는 작업을 처리하려고 할 때, 만약 A라는 작업이 완료하는데 오랜 시간이 걸린다면 A가 처리될 때까지 기다린 후 B를 처리해야한다. 이러한 동기식 처리는 코드 한줄 한줄을 차례대로 실행하기 때문에 위와같은 상황에선 시간과 자원의 낭비 문제가 심각해진다. 그래서 JavaScript는 비동기적 처리가 가능하도록 설계되어 이러한 문제점을 해결했다. 2. 비동기(Asynchronous)적 처리란? 동기(Synchronous)적 처리는 말그대로 작업을 ..
내 블로그 - 관리자 홈 전환 |
Q
Q
|
---|---|
새 글 쓰기 |
W
W
|
글 수정 (권한 있는 경우) |
E
E
|
---|---|
댓글 영역으로 이동 |
C
C
|
이 페이지의 URL 복사 |
S
S
|
---|---|
맨 위로 이동 |
T
T
|
티스토리 홈 이동 |
H
H
|
단축키 안내 |
Shift + /
⇧ + /
|
* 단축키는 한글/영문 대소문자로 이용 가능하며, 티스토리 기본 도메인에서만 동작합니다.